The Vulnerable Populations Coordinator (VPC) serves as a key liaison within the Healthcare Coalition (HCC) and Regional Health Department to improve preparedness, response, and recovery for at-risk populations who may be disproportionately impacted by disasters and public health emergencies. Working under the guidance of the Tennessee Department of Health (TDH) and/or the Regional Healthcare Coordinator (RHC) / Emergency Response Coordinator (ERC) the VPC supports outreach, planning, training, and response initiatives that reduce health disparities and advance health equity across the region.


Essential Duties & Responsibilities

· Coordinate with Healthcare Coalitions (HCCs), healthcare facilities, and community organizations to integrate the needs of vulnerable populations into all phases of emergency preparedness and response.

· Develop, implement, and maintain partnerships with long-term care, hospice, home health, dialysis, assisted living, behavioral health, and other providers serving vulnerable groups.

· Provide ongoing support for vaccination efforts and infectious disease response, including planning and operating Points of Distribution (PODs).

· Deliver regular training and technical assistance on the Healthcare Resource Tracking System (HRTS) and Patient Bed Matching (PBM); serve as the regional SME for PBM.

· Maintain coalition contact lists, inventories, and preventive maintenance logs for coalition-owned assets.

· Develop and update resource lists of agencies and vendors that support vulnerable populations (e.g., medical equipment providers, food banks, housing services, NGOs).

· Facilitate outreach and host quarterly meetings with population-specific partners to enhance preparedness and participation in HCCs.

· Collaborate with government agencies, NGOs, and local coalitions (health councils, LEPCs, drug coalitions, etc.) to strengthen community-wide engagement.

· Support regional exercises and contribute to After-Action Reports/Improvement Plans that address gaps for vulnerable populations.

· Assist with reporting requirements, data management, and compliance with ASPR HPP and CDC PHEP program guidance.

· Aid during emergencies and disaster activations, including logistical and response support to the RHC and HCC.

· Additional duties as directed by RHC’s / ERCs.

The Senior Manager of Inventory Control & Quality provides strategic and operational leadership across two critical functional in Greenfield, Indiana. This leader is accountable for establishing and sustaining best-in-class inventory accuracy across a food-grade 3PL environment, while concurrently owning the administration and continuous improvement of the facility's food safety management system through FSSC 22000 certification and ongoing compliance.

This role requires a practitioner — someone equally at home interpreting cycle count variance data and leading a food safety audit preparation — who brings external industry benchmarks and modern inventory control methodology to a team that is technically experienced but primed for structured development. The position reports to the Director of Continuous Improvement and carries direct supervisory responsibility for the inventory control function.

Key Responsibilities

INVENTORY CONTROL LEADERSHIP

  • Define and own the facility's inventory accuracy strategy, including cycle count methodology, variance thresholds, root cause analysis protocols, and corrective action workflows
  • Establish and track key performance metrics including net unit accuracy, location accuracy, and shrink attribution by root cause category
  • Lead integration and optimization of drone-assisted cycle count operations, partnering with technology vendors and WMS teams to build sustainable, paper-light workflows
  • Develop and administer formal standard operating procedures (SOPs) for all inventory control functions — receiving, putaway, pick confirmation, cycle counting, and adjustments
  • Build inventory control team competency through structured training, performance feedback, and accountability frameworks
  • Analyze variance trends and present findings and corrective actions to senior leadership in a clear, datadriven format

QUALITY & FOOD SAFETY MANAGEMENT

  • Own the ongoing administration, compliance, and continuous improvement of the FSSC 22000 food safety management system post-certification
  • Serve as the facility's primary point of contact for internal and external food safety audits, including Stage 1 and Stage 2 FSSC 22000 certification audits
  • Partner with the quality systems contractor during program build-out to ensure deep ownership of all documentation, HACCP controls, and prerequisite programs
  • Maintain document control discipline across all quality records, corrective action reports (CARs), and food safety monitoring logs
  • Lead internal audit preparation, gap assessments, and mock audit exercises
  • Drive food safety culture across the facility through training, communication, and visible leadership

CROSS-FUNCTIONAL & LEADERSHIP

  • Partner with operations, client services, and technology teams to ensure inventory and quality standards are embedded in daily workflows
  • Represent inventory accuracy and food safety performance in client QBRs and operational reviews
  • Proactively identify process improvement opportunities and lead CI initiatives within scope
